Old English

Etymology

From Proto-West Germanic *gatilljan, from Proto-Germanic *gatiljaną, equivalent to ġe- +‎ tillan. Compare Old High German gizilēn (to hit, plunge, overthrow, hurl down).

Verb

ġetillan

  1. to touch
  2. to reach, attain
